Holiday Road Open House Weekend

When: 1-5 p.m. Nov. 11; 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. Nov. 12; 1-5 p.m. Nov. 13

Where: 30 stops through Habersham, Rabun, White and Lumpkin counties

Cost: Free

 

The Northeast Georgia Arts Tour Holiday Road Open House Weekend takes place Nov. 11-13.

Explore North Georgia while taking in live demonstrations by local artists.

At various stops along the route, artisans will be working on their crafts and selling their wares. It's a good chance to get a jump on your Christmas list.

This self-guided driving and walking tour will take you through Habersham, Rabun, White and Lumpkin counties. Meet more than 100 painters, potters, jewelry makers, wood turners, fiber artists, photographers and other artisans and find the best places to dine and lodge.

Register to win prizes, such as theater tickets, restaurant gift certificates and an original oil painting at all tour stops.

The tour makes for a great day trip or weekend getaway.

And the best part about the tour? Supporting local arts and local commerce. From wineries to galleries, North Georgia has a lot to offer those willing to get out and experience it.
